Andres Osvet is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Polymers and Plastics. According to data from OpenAlex, Andres Osvet has authored 180 papers receiving a total of 6.8k indexed citations (citations by other indexed papers that have themselves been cited), including 127 papers in Materials Chemistry, 126 papers in Electrical and Electronic Engineering and 35 papers in Polymers and Plastics. Recurrent topics in Andres Osvet's work include Perovskite Materials and Applications (81 papers), Luminescence Properties of Advanced Materials (59 papers) and Quantum Dots Synthesis And Properties (36 papers). Andres Osvet is often cited by papers focused on Perovskite Materials and Applications (81 papers), Luminescence Properties of Advanced Materials (59 papers) and Quantum Dots Synthesis And Properties (36 papers). Andres Osvet collaborates with scholars based in Germany, China and Ukraine. Andres Osvet's co-authors include Christoph J. Brabec, Miroslaw Batentschuk, Ievgen Levchuk, Gebhard J. Matt, Xiaofeng Tang, Rainer Hock, Ning Li, Shreetu Shrestha, Luigi Pinna and A. Winnacker and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Physical Review Letters.
